Abstract
This paper deals with security of logistic chains according to incorrect declaration of transported goods, fraudulent transport and forwarding companies and possible threats caused by political influences. The main goal of this paper is to highlight possible logistic costs increase due to these fraudulent threats. An analysis of technological processes will beis provided, and an increase of these transport times considering the possible threatswhich will beis evaluated economic costs-wise. In the conclusion, possible threat of companies’‘ efficiency in logistics due to the costs‘, means of transport and increase in human resources‘ increase will beare pointed out.
